Mayco
Since 1981, U.S. Social Security records show 242 babies named Mayco, peaking in 2009. See the year-by-year trend, decade totals, and state rankings below, sourced from federal birth data.

Mayco's usage pattern, beyond the headline number
Divide Mayco's SSA record in two at 2006 and the more recent half accounts for 57%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 43%, a genuinely balanced usage pattern. Its calmest year was 1981, with only 5 births recorded -- set against the 2009 peak of 12,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.

Mayco by decade
Total births in each ten-year window, peak vs trough at a glance
2000s was Mayco's strongest decade.
68 babies received the name during that ten-year window, about 28% of all-time use.
